Indian Army helicopter crashes into a lake in IOK’s Kathua district
Earlier today, an Indian Army helicopter crashed into the Ranjit Sagar Dam lake in Jammu and Kashmir’s Kathua district. According to reports, both the pilots were safe. The cause of the crash is still unknown.

Hand grenade blast in Peshawar: Policeman martyred, another injured
Earlier today, a police vehicle in Peshawar's Karkhano market was attacked with a hand grenade. According to official reports, one policeman was martyred. Police are currently investigating whether the blast was a terrorist attack or an accident.
Sindh under lockdown till August 8th as Covid Delta variant takes over
Due to the dire Covid situation in Karachi, CM Murad Ali Shah announces a lockdown till August 8th. As per the official orders, only vaccinated persons will be allowed on the roads after showing their vaccine cards.

PM Khan in hot waters as ECP issues notice for not holding intra-party polls
As per the Elections Act, 2017, all political parties are bound to conduct intra-party elections within five years. However, PTI failed to do so. As a result, the ECP served PM Khan with a show-cause notice for not holding intra-party polls.
Police to arrest health officials involved in Karachi’s vaccine scam
After intense investigation, three officials from the Sindh Health Department are involved in Karachi's Covid vaccine scam. According to the police, officials employed two people to work for them and illegally administer vaccines door-to-door for Rs. 7,500 to Rs. 15,000.
